[发明专利]报表生成方法、系统、电子设备及存储介质在审
申请号: | 202211030892.0 | 申请日: | 2022-08-26 |
公开(公告)号: | CN115357648A | 公开(公告)日: | 2022-11-18 |
发明(设计)人: | 李恒昌;徐海东;刘慧慧;司树康;甘剑锋 | 申请(专利权)人: | 度小满科技(北京)有限公司 |
主分类号: | G06F16/248 | 分类号: | G06F16/248;G06F16/28;G06F40/174 |
代理公司: | 北京博浩百睿知识产权代理有限责任公司 11134 | 代理人: | 赵昀彬 |
地址: | 100193 北京市海淀区*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 报表 生成 方法 系统 电子设备 存储 介质 | ||
本发明公开了一种报表生成方法、系统、电子设备及存储介质。其中报表生成方法包括:响应于报表生成请求,获取配置参数,其中,报表生成请求中携带有时间参数;基于时间参数和配置参数,从预设数据仓库中获取目标报表数据,其中,预设数据仓库基于预设数据模型构建,预设数据仓库用于存储候选报表数据,预设数据模型用于表征候选报表数据之间的关系;根据配置参数,将目标报表数据填充至预设报表模板中以生成目标报表。本发明解决了无法对未定制的报表进行自动生成,从而导致报表生成效率低下的技术问题。
技术领域
本发明涉及数据处理技术领域,具体而言,涉及报表生成方法、系统、电子设备及存储介质。
背景技术
不管是金融的领域,还是电商、物流等行业,都会面临行业监管的问题,都需要按照监管机构的要求按周、或者按照月季的频率,定期的披露一些数据。抑或是在公司的财务报表统计中,财务也会按照固定的EXCEL表格让业务帮忙定期的往里面填充数字,而在这个过程中,EXCEL统计表格是大家比较常用的一个工具,所以在各公司中都会有专门负责报表生成和报表报送的人员。
在此过程中,现有技术是通过平台化的方案完成。通过在Web界面定制一个报表查询结果,然后报送人员登录到该界面,点击查询,系统生成EXCEL报表,然后在下载页面进行报表的下载。但是由于报表查询结果是定制的,无法对未定制的报表进行生成,需要对平台进行额外的开发才能使平台进一步的可以生成其他报表,从而导致报表生成的效率低下。
发明内容
本发明实施例提供了一种报表生成方法、系统、电子设备及存储介质,以至少解决无法对未定制的报表进行自动生成,从而导致报表生成效率低下的技术问题。
根据本发明实施例的一个方面,提供了一种报表生成方法,包括:
响应于报表生成请求,获取配置参数,其中,报表生成请求中携带有时间参数;基于时间参数和配置参数,从预设数据仓库中获取目标报表数据,其中,预设数据仓库基于预设数据模型构建,预设数据仓库用于存储候选报表数据,预设数据模型用于表征候选报表数据之间的关系;根据配置参数,将目标报表数据填充至预设报表模板中以生成目标报表。
可选的,配置参数至少包括:子表名称、填充位置、多条查询语句和查询语句描述;其中,目标报表包括至少一个子表,子表名称用于表征目标报表中的子表的名称,填充位置用于表征目标报表数据填充时的起始位置,查询语句用于查询目标报表数据,查询语句描述用于表征查询语句对应的目标报表的指标。
可选的,基于时间参数和配置参数,从预设数据仓库中获取目标报表数据包括:将时间参数设置于预设查询语句中得到查询语句;利用查询语句,从预设数据仓库中查询得到目标报表数据。
可选的,利用查询语句,从预设数据仓库中查询得到目标报表数据包括:基于大规模并行分析数据库,串行执行多条查询语句,从预设数据仓库中查询得到目标报表数据。
可选的,根据配置参数,将目标报表数据填充至预设报表模板中以生成目标报表包括:根据子表名称和填充位置,将目标报表数据填充至预设报表模板中得到基础报表;根据预设公式和目标报表数据得到计算数据,其中,预设公式预设于预设报表模板中;将计算数据填充至基础报表中生成目标报表。
可选的,上述报表生成方法还包括:预设多个模板主题;为预设报表模板设定主题参数;根据主题参数将预设报表模板与模板主题匹配。
可选的,预设数据模型为星座模型或星型模型。
根据本发明其中一实施例,还提供了一报表生成系统,包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于度小满科技(北京)有限公司,未经度小满科技(北京)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202211030892.0/2.html,转载请声明来源钻瓜专利网。